Morning Rituals to Jumpstart Your Day
# Wake up early
Embrace the proverb "the early bird gets the worm." Start your day before the world awakens, giving yourself ample time to gather your thoughts and prioritize tasks. This early morning solitude allows you to set intentions, plan your day, and lay the foundation for a productive jornada.
# Exercise and meditation
Incorporate physical activity and meditation into your morning routine to clear your mind, energize your body, and reduce stress levels. Exercise releases endorphins, improving your mood and cognitive performance, while meditation cultivates a sense of calm and focus, helping you approach your day with greater clarity.
Midday Momentum: Powering through the Afternoon
# Prioritize tasks using the Eisenhower Matrix
To maximize your productivity, employ the Eisenhower Matrix. This time management tool categorizes tasks based on urgency and importance. Focus on tackling high-priority tasks first, delegating or eliminating less urgent items to free up your time.
# Schedule breaks
Avoid burnout by scheduling regular breaks throughout the day. Step away from your desk, move your body, and engage in activities that refresh and recharge you. Studies have shown that short breaks can significantly enhance productivity and creativity.
Evening Wind-down: Transitioning to Rest
# Review and plan for the next day
Before calling it a day, take some time to reflect on your accomplishments, identify areas for improvement, and plan for the following day. This proactive approach ensures you hit the ground running each morning and minimizes the stress of "to-do" lists.
# Unplug and recharge
As the day draws to a close, disconnect from technology and engage in relaxing activities that promote well-being. Spend time with loved ones, pursue hobbies, or simply unwind with a good book. By creating a clear separation between work and personal time, you can foster a healthy work-life balance.
Sample Daily Routine Table
Time | Activity | Duration |
---|---|---|
5:00 AM | Wake up, exercise, and meditate | 1 hour |
7:00 AM | Review priorities, plan the day, and check emails | 30 minutes |
8:00 AM | Tackle high-priority tasks | 2 hours |
10:00 AM | Take a 15-minute break | 15 minutes |
10:15 AM | Continue working on priority tasks | 1 hour |
12:00 PM | Lunch break | 30 minutes |
1:00 PM | Schedule appointments, meetings, and phone calls | 2 hours |
3:00 PM | Take a 15-minute break | 15 minutes |
3:15 PM | Delegate or eliminate low-priority tasks | 1 hour |
5:00 PM | Review progress, plan for the next day, and disconnect from work | 30 minutes |
6:00 PM | Engage in personal activities, hobbies, or relaxation | 2 hours |
8:00 PM | Prepare for bed, read, or unwind | 1 hour |

FAQ about Daily Routine for Business Owners
What are the essential tasks for a daily routine?
- Check emails and respond to urgent messages.
- Plan and prioritize tasks for the day.
- Conduct meetings or calls with your team.
- Review progress and make necessary adjustments.
- Delegate tasks and provide guidance to employees.
- Network and connect with potential clients or partners.
How can I prioritize tasks effectively?
- Use the Eisenhower Matrix to categorize tasks based on urgency and importance.
- Focus on the most important and urgent tasks first.
- Break down large tasks into smaller, manageable steps.
- Delegate or outsource tasks that can be handled by others.
How do I manage time efficiently?
- Establish specific time slots for different tasks.
- Use a calendar or task manager to keep track of appointments and deadlines.
- Minimize distractions and create a dedicated workspace.
- Take breaks throughout the day to avoid burnout.
